This affects any SR-IOV > capable driver that calls pci_disable_sriov() from its .remove() > callback (i40e, ice, mlx5, bnxt, etc.). >=20 > On s390, platform-generated hot-unplug events for VFs can race with > sriov_del_vfs() when a PF driver is being unloaded. The platform event > handler takes pci_rescan_remove_lock, but sriov_del_vfs() does not, > leading to double removal and list corruption. >=20 > We cannot use a plain mutex_lock() here because sriov_del_vfs() may also > be called from paths that already hold pci_rescan_remove_lock (e.g. > remove_store -> pci_stop_and_remove_bus_device_locked, or > sriov_numvfs_store with the lock taken by the previous patch). Using > mutex_lock() in those cases would deadlock. >=20 > Make pci_lock_rescan_remove() itself reentrant using mutex_get_owner() > and a reentrant depth counter, as suggested by Lukas Wunner and > Benjamin Block, since these recursive locking scenarios exist elsewhere > in the PCI subsystem: > - If the lock is already held by the current task (checked via > mutex_get_owner()): increments the reentrant counter and returns > without re-acquiring, avoiding deadlock. > - If the lock is held by another task: blocks until the lock is > released, providing complete serialization. > - If the lock is not held: acquires the mutex normally. >=20 > pci_unlock_rescan_remove() decrements the reentrant counter if it is > non-zero, otherwise releases the mutex. >=20 > This approach keeps the API unchanged: callers simply pair lock/unlock > calls without needing to track any return value or use separate > reentrant variants. >=20 > Add pci_lock_rescan_remove()/pci_unlock_rescan_remove() calls to > sriov_add_vfs() and sriov_del_vfs() to protect VF addition and > removal against concurrent hotplug events. >=20 > Fixes: 18f9e9d150fc ("PCI/IOV: Factor out sriov_add_vfs()") I think this should have an additional fixes tag for commit=20 05703271c3cd ("PCI/IOV: Add PCI rescan-remove locking when enabling/disabling SR-IOV") and commit a5338e365c45 ("PCI/IOV: Fix race between SR-IOV enable/disable and hotplug") especially if you incorporate my suggestion below but even without it. > Cc: stable@vger.kernel.org > Suggested-by: Lukas Wunner > Suggested-by: Benjamin Block > Signed-off-by: Ionut Nechita > Signed-off-by: Ionut Nechita > --- > drivers/pci/iov.c | 5 +++++ > drivers/pci/probe.c | 11 +++++++++-- > 2 files changed, 14 insertions(+), 2 deletions(-) >=20 > diff --git a/drivers/pci/iov.c b/drivers/pci/iov.c > index 91ac4e37ecb9c..aba2fb90759cd 100644 > --- a/drivers/pci/iov.c > +++ b/drivers/pci/iov.c > @@ -633,15 +633,18 @@ static int sriov_add_vfs(struct pci_dev *dev, u16 n= um_vfs) > if (dev->no_vf_scan) > return 0; > =20 > + pci_lock_rescan_remove(); > for (i =3D 0; i < num_vfs; i++) { > rc =3D pci_iov_add_virtfn(dev, i); > if (rc) > goto failed; > } > + pci_unlock_rescan_remove(); > return 0; > failed: > while (i--) > pci_iov_remove_virtfn(dev, i); > + pci_unlock_rescan_remove(); > =20 > return rc; > } > @@ -766,8 +769,10 @@ static void sriov_del_vfs(struct pci_dev *dev) > struct pci_sriov *iov =3D dev->sriov; > int i; > =20 > + pci_lock_rescan_remove(); > for (i =3D 0; i < iov->num_VFs; i++) > pci_iov_remove_virtfn(dev, i); > + pci_unlock_rescan_remove(); > } So basically after making the rescan/remove lock reentrant we can now use it in the same spot as I did in commit 05703271c3cd ("PCI/IOV: Add PCI rescan-remove locking when enabling/disabling SR-IOV") only now it doesn't deadlock via self-lock during device removal. With that I think you could actually remove the rescan/remove locking in sriov_numvfs_store() introduced by commit a5338e365c45 ("PCI/IOV: Fix race between SR-IOV enable/disable and hotplug") as part of this patch. That way for the price of making the lock reentrant we are able to reduce its scope. It does otherwise seem a bit weird, though harmless with the reentrant behavior, to take it in both sriov_numvfs_store() and then again in sriov_add_vfs()/sriov_del_vfs(). > =20 > static void sriov_disable(struct pci_dev *dev) > diff --git a/drivers/pci/probe.c b/drivers/pci/probe.c > index bccc7a4bdd794..ce4d351b5aa21 100644 > --- a/drivers/pci/probe.c > +++ b/drivers/pci/probe.c > @@ -3509,16 +3509,23 @@ EXPORT_SYMBOL_GPL(pci_rescan_bus); > * routines should always be executed under this mutex. > */ > DEFINE_MUTEX(pci_rescan_remove_lock); > +static size_t pci_rescan_remove_reentrant_count; > =20 > void pci_lock_rescan_remove(void) > { > - mutex_lock(&pci_rescan_remove_lock); > + if (mutex_get_owner(&pci_rescan_remove_lock) =3D=3D (unsigned long)curr= ent) > + pci_rescan_remove_reentrant_count++; > + else > + mutex_lock(&pci_rescan_remove_lock); > } > EXPORT_SYMBOL_GPL(pci_lock_rescan_remove); > =20 > void pci_unlock_rescan_remove(void) > { > - mutex_unlock(&pci_rescan_remove_lock); > + if (pci_rescan_remove_reentrant_count > 0) > + pci_rescan_remove_reentrant_count--; > + else > + mutex_unlock(&pci_rescan_remove_lock); > } > EXPORT_SYMBOL_GPL(pci_unlock_rescan_remove); I still don't particularly love making the lock reentrant but I also haven't been able to come up with anything cleaner for handling the remove paths. This is especially true for s390 where removing the last passed-through PCI function (struct zpci_dev) on a shared virtual PCI bus also logically removes the virtual PCI bus while also having to hold onto the struct zpci_dev until the corresponding struct pci_dev is released.=C2=A0So this is why Benjamin's series for s390 now strictly depends on this patch to get that part safe without having to introduce rescan/remove locking in pci_release_dev() which seemed quite wrong to me. Long story short. Until a major tree-wide refactoring of the rescan/remove lock this seems like the cleanest path forward to me and I thank you for tackling this.
